I have had 2 of these in the UK. Amps both work fine with my active basses, but with passive bass or my active basses switched to passive, there is a "Hum" when the guitar volume control is backed off from full. Mesa say they couldn't recreate the problem with the first amp when it was sent back to them. The USA store say they did have the problem on the amp when it was sent back to them, and they sent it back to Mesa. The store tested a second amp which was fine, but when I tried that in the UK, it had the same "Hum" problem as the original.
I have to say apart from the "Hum" issue, the amp is great and because I don't use passive mode on my basses, it has become my first call amp...D800 is now spare and or used for louder gigs.
All cables/mains checked.....the Hum issue doesn't happen with my D800 or D800+ di.
D800+ di fed to the aux in on the D350 is also fine, suggesting a D350 input/preamp problem.
Hum happens with my 3 Sadowsky's in passive mode. Also my Xotic jazz bass. Also happens with other basses I've tried..Fender Jazz Bass, Maruszczyk Jake PJ and a Gibson jazz guitar.
